What Sets Pediatric Dentists Apart
Pediatric dentistry is a specialized branch of dentistry that requires advanced education and training beyond dental school. Understanding what makes pediatric dentists uniquely qualified can help you appreciate the value they bring to your child's care.
Specialized Training: After completing four years of dental school, pediatric dentists complete an additional two to three years of residency training focused exclusively on children's dental development, behavior management, and treating dental conditions specific to young patients. This specialized education ensures they understand how to care for growing smiles from infancy through the teenage years.
Child-Centered Approach: Pediatric dentists are trained in techniques that help children feel comfortable and safe during dental visits. They understand developmental milestones, communication strategies that work with different age groups, and how to create positive associations with dental care that last a lifetime.

Services Your Pediatric Dentist Should Offer
A comprehensive pediatric dental practice provides a full spectrum of services designed to meet children's evolving dental needs from infancy through adolescence.
1. Preventive Care and Checkups
Regular preventive visits form the foundation of excellent pediatric dental care. These appointments include thorough cleanings, fluoride treatments, dental sealants, and education about proper brushing and flossing techniques. Preventive care helps identify potential problems early, before they develop into more serious conditions requiring extensive treatment.
2. Restorative Dentistry
When cavities or dental injuries occur, pediatric restorative care addresses these issues using child-friendly techniques and materials. Tooth-colored fillings, stainless steel crowns, and other restorative treatments are performed with a gentle approach that minimizes discomfort and anxiety.
3. Sedation Options for Anxious Children
For children with significant dental anxiety or those requiring extensive treatment, sedation dentistry provides safe, comfortable options. From mild sedation to help children relax to deeper sedation for complex procedures, these techniques ensure your child receives necessary care without fear or stress.
4. Emergency Dental Care
Accidents happen, and having a pediatric dentist who provides prompt emergency care for knocked-out teeth, dental injuries, or severe toothaches gives parents peace of mind. Emergency services should be readily accessible when your child needs immediate attention.
5. Developmental Monitoring and Orthodontic Screening
Pediatric dentists monitor jaw development, tooth eruption patterns, and bite alignment throughout childhood. Early orthodontic screening can identify issues that benefit from intervention during optimal developmental windows, potentially reducing the need for more extensive treatment later.
How to Make Your Child's First Visit Positive
The first dental visit sets the tone for your child's relationship with dental care. Taking simple steps to prepare can help ensure a positive experience.
- Schedule wisely: Choose an appointment time when your child is typically well-rested and cooperative, such as mid-morning for younger children.
- Use positive language: Talk about the visit in an upbeat, matter-of-fact way without mentioning words like "pain," "hurt," or "shot."
- Read children's books about dental visits: Many excellent books normalize dental checkups and make them seem fun and interesting.
- Arrive early: Give your child time to explore the waiting area and adjust to the new environment before the appointment begins.
- Let the dental team lead: Trust the pediatric dental team to explain procedures in age-appropriate ways—they're trained in communication techniques that work.
Planning your child's first visit with intention and positivity creates a foundation for years of stress-free dental care.
